Srinagar Earns ‘World Craft City’ Tag, Reconnecting Globally Through Artistry

Srinagar Earns ‘World Craft City’ Tag, Reconnecting Globally Through Artistry

Saleem Beg, head of the Indian National Trust for Art and Cultural Heritage-Kashmir (INTACH-K), described the honour as “the latest recognition of the skill base of Kashmir” Srinagar has earned the World Craft City (WCC) tag from the World Crafts Council (WCC), a non-government organisation working to empower artisans and safeguard craft heritage globally. This is likely to reopen Kashmir’s centuries old linkages with craft centres in Central Asia and Iran.
